Understanding Electricity Consumption Dehumidifiers vary in their power consumption. Some models consume more electricity due to their larger size and higher extraction capacity. However, these high-capacity units aren't always in operation mode, which can offset their overall energy use. Factors like room size, humidity levels, and how often you run the device play a vital role. I learned from the provided resource that newer models are more energy-efficient, employing advanced technology to save power. It's crucial to consider these aspects before purchasing a dehumidifier. An oversized unit may unnecessarily consume more electricity, while an undersized one might continuously run, leading to higher bills. FAQs About Dehumidifier Electricity Consumption How do I know if my dehumidifier is energy-efficient? Energy Star labels on appliances indicate their efficiency. Look for this label when purchasing a dehumidifier. Does running a dehumidifier increase my electricity bill significantly? The impact on your electricity bill depends on various factors, but efficient usage typically doesn't lead to a significant increase. Should I run my dehumidifier all the time? It's recommended to run it when necessary. Most units have humidity settings, allowing them to turn on and off automatically. Can a smaller dehumidifier consume less electricity? A smaller unit might consume less energy initially, but an undersized one might run more frequently, potentially increasing overall energy consumption. Do dehumidifiers with additional features consume more electricity? Extra features like timers or air purifiers might increase energy use slightly but might also improve efficiency in the long run. Can maintenance affect electricity consumption? Yes, regular cleaning and upkeep can optimize a dehumidifier's efficiency, impacting its electricity consumption positively. Remote work has become increasingly popular in recent years, with many businesses allowing employees to work from home at least part-time. There are many potential benefits to remote work, including increased productivity, reduced stress, and improved work-life balance. A study by Stanford University found that remote workers were 13% more productive than their in-office counterparts. This was due to a number of factors, including the lack of distractions, the ability to work at their own pace, and the increased flexibility that remote work allows. Remote work can also help to reduce stress levels. A study by the American Psychological Association found that employees who worked from home reported lower levels of stress than those who worked in an office. This was due to the fact that remote workers were able to avoid the stress of commuting, the stress of office politics, and the stress of being constantly monitored. Finally, remote work can help to improve work-life balance. Employees who work from home are able to better manage their time and responsibilities, which can lead to a better overall sense of well-being.
